ueberzugpp (drop in replacement for ueberzug written in C++)
Ueberzug++ is a command line utility written in C++ which allows to
draw images on terminals by using X11/wayland child windows, sixels,
kitty and iterm2 protocols or chafa.
This project intends to be a drop-in replacement for the now
defunct ueberzug project (https://github.com/seebye/ueberzug).
Options:
* WAYLAND=yes -- enable support for wayland (window positioning is
correct only for sway and hyprland)
NOTE: Do not install at the same time with "ueberzug" package!
Both provide /usr/bin/ueberzug.
This requires: vips, nlohmann_json, oneTBB, CLI11, libsixel, chafa, microsoft-gsl, fmt, spdlog
